Front desk attendant vs guest services agent

The differences between front desk attendants and guest services agents can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. Additionally, a guest services agent has an average salary of $29,063, which is higher than the $26,874 average annual salary of a front desk attendant.

The top three skills for a front desk attendant include reservations, customer service and cleanliness. The most important skills for a guest services agent are reservations, computer system, and hotel services.

What does a front desk attendant do?

A front desk attendant serves as the primary point of contact in a building or establishment, ensuring customer satisfaction. Their duties mainly revolve around greeting visitors, responding to inquiries, handling calls and correspondence, arranging appointments, and coordinating with various building offices and departments. Moreover, a front desk attendant's responsibilities will vary on the line of work or one's industry of employment. There are instances in a hotel setting where they must handle check-in and check-out processes, make reservations, and offer amenities.

What does a guest services agent do?

Guest services agents are the ones who communicate with hotel guests who want to reserve or cancel bookings. Their job includes welcoming guests upon arrival, assigning them their rooms and suites, issuing their room keys, and collecting payment information. They organize housekeeping, transport providers, porters, and kitchen staff to meet the requirements of guests. They also resolve issues and deal with disappointed guests' complaints and coordinate third party services, including taxis, rental cars, tour guides, and airport transfers.
